Solution Overview
Problem
Existing methods for error detection in nonvolatile memory, such as CRC and checksum, require external computation and storage of check codes, making the process complex and inefficient.
Innovation Solution
A circuit apparatus that includes an interface circuit and a control circuit capable of generating error detection data based on setting data, allowing for internal computation and storage of error detection data alongside setting data in nonvolatile memory, simplifying the error detection process.

A circuit apparatus 100 includes: an interface circuit 120 that receives setting data; and a control circuit 110 that controls the operations of the circuit apparatus 100 based on the setting data and also controls access to a nonvolatile memory 10. The control circuit 110 generates error detection data based on the setting data received by the interface circuit 120, and writes the setting data and the error detection data to the nonvolatile memory 10.
